Koenigsegg, the company that made the car that broke the 10 year McLaren F1’s top speed world record. Started in 1994, this company was founded by Christian Von Koenigsegg. Von Koenigsegg always dreamt of making a perfect sports car - a two seater supercar that had a hardtop and with a mid engine layout based on Formula One technology. Von, in his early twenties started a trading company, the success of which allowed him to start his own car company and make the supercar he wanted to.

The Koenigsegg project was started in 1993. The design was by designer David Craaford following Von’s guidelines. A fully functional prototype was made in just 1.5 years. It was then exposed to the media and people. The car was tested in the Volvo wind tunnel and also tested on race tracks. The car was so smooth; it had a low drag coefficient of only 0.30 whereas the Mercedes SLR has a value of 0.37 and the enzo Ferrari a value of 0.36. A darker side was the low downforce of only 50Kg at the front and 70Kg at the back. A unique thing about Koenigsegg cars is that they have windscreen sorrounding the whole cabin. It also has a removable roof. It was shown at the Cannes film festival and gained much popularity very rapidly. A carbon fibre monocoque was added to the chassis. The car was made to comply with international certification regulations by making it go through 57 different tests. A new facility near Angelholm was set up.

In the year 2000, the production of Koenigsegg CC8S was started. The car won many awards and was chosen as the car of the year in Swedish magazine Automobil. In 2002, the first customer bought a red Koenigsegg CC 8S. The Koenigsegg Company moved an F10 Air Force Base near Angelholm due to a major fire in their production facilities. In the same year, Koenigsegg made the world record for the most powerful streetcar. In 2004, work on the CCR began which produced 806 hp @ 6900 rpm. The car broke the world record of the fastest car in history with a top speed of 388.87 Km/Hr which was later beaten by Bugatti Veyron.
Recently, the CCX has been launched which is the most advanced model of Koenigsegg. It broke the record of Pagani Zonda on the Top Gear Race track, beating it by 0.8 seconds. Presently, 7 vehicles can be assembled simultaneously in the Koenigsegg facility. The car uses more than 300 carbon fibre and other expensive components which is why Koenigsegg cars are so high priced.
